Jeanologia Unveils AI Textile Finishing Model 2026

Published: 17/04/2026
Author: Fashion Value Chain

Jeanologia, a global leader in eco-efficient textile technologies, is showcasing a new sustainable garment finishing model at Indo Intertex 2026, taking place from April 15 to 18 at the Jakarta International Expo. The event brings together key stakeholders from across the Asia-Pacific textile value chain.

At the exhibition, the company introduces an integrated system combining its artificial intelligence platform “Billy”, laser technology, and G2 Ozone. This approach is designed to transform garment finishing processes into more automated, efficient and environmentally responsible operations.

Building on over 25 years of innovation, Jeanologia continues to advance its laser technology, which originally replaced manual processes such as hand sanding and sandblasting, both known for their environmental impact and health risks. The latest model integrates AI and air-based washing solutions, enabling more precise, clean and efficient production.

Digital creativity with industrial precision
At Indo Intertex 2026, Jeanologia demonstrates enhancements in its laser systems powered by the Billy AI platform. This integration improves design accuracy and consistency, allowing precise replication of vintage effects, wear patterns and complex finishes without manual intervention.

Live demonstrations feature the Compact Super laser system, highlighting its high-speed processing capabilities, improved productivity and consistent output in industrial settings. Increased automation and execution speed enable manufacturers to meet evolving demands for efficiency, digitalisation and sustainability.

The ozone revolution
Complementing laser technology, Jeanologia is also presenting its Atmos process, powered by G2 Ozone and Indra technology. This system replaces traditional water-intensive washing methods with air-based treatments.

G2 Ozone converts oxygen into ozone, acting as a natural oxidising agent for indigo. This enables cleaning, tone adjustment and finishing effects such as abrasion, marbling and colour variation without the use of pumice stones or harmful chemicals. The process significantly reduces water consumption while maintaining high-quality finishes.

The combined use of AI, laser and ozone technologies allows manufacturers to achieve authentic garment aesthetics with minimal environmental impact and no hazardous substances, aligning with the company’s Mission Zero initiative to eliminate water usage and toxic chemicals in textile production.

Asia driving textile transformation
The Asia-Pacific region continues to lead global textile manufacturing, with increasing emphasis on automation, sustainability and traceability. Rising international standards and competitive pressures are accelerating the adoption of advanced production technologies across the region.

Jeanologia has maintained a strong presence in Asia for over two decades, supporting manufacturers and exporters with technological solutions, consultancy and local technical expertise. This long-standing engagement positions the company as a strategic partner in the industry’s transition towards cleaner and more efficient processes.

Commenting on the evolving landscape, Jean-Pierre Inchauspe, Jeanologia’s Business Director for Asia at Jeanologia, said:
“Competitiveness in the textile industry is no longer measured solely in terms of cost, but in the ability to produce efficiently, with traceability and sustainability. The factories adopting this model in Asia are the ones that will lead the global supply chain in the coming years,”
